PPA TOUR ASIA TOURNAMENT PRO EVENT ENTRY & SEEDING REGULATIONS

TOURNAMENT FORMATS

Open Format: 16 slot Main Draw with standard elite player entry restrictions. 
Cup Format: 32 slot Main Draw with no elite player restrictions. 

1. ENTRY SYSTEM 

All players who enter a PPA Tour Asia Pro event are initially placed on a Waitlist. Entry to an event does not guarantee a position in either the Main Draw or Qualifying Draw. Entries may be excluded at the sole discretion of PPA Tour Asia.

1.1 Waitlist Processing 

Following registration closing, players on the Waitlist shall be processed according to the entry priority system and allocated to: 

  • Main Draw (based on available positions) 
  • Qualifying Draw (based on available positions) 
  • No position (insufficent availability) 
     

PPA Tour Asia will endeavor to notify players of their status two weeks prior to the start of the tournament. Players requiring a letter of support from PPA Tour Asia for visa applications may request this prior to this date.

1.2 Draw Size

Open Format: 

  • Main Draw: 16 players/pairs 
  • Up to four (4) places to be determined from Qualifying 
  • Qualifying: Based on available positions 


Cup Format: 

  • Main Draw: 24 players/pairs 
  • Top 8 seeds receive first-round byes to Round of 16 
  • Up to eight (8) places to be determined from Qualifying 

Qualifying: Based on available positions  

1.3 Entry Priority 

1.3.1 Open Format Entry Priority 

Entries for Open Format tournaments shall be processed as follows, based on rankings captured at registration closing: 

  1. Players positioned in the Top 21-50 of the PPA Tour Rankings (inclusive of their partners in doubles events). Note: Players Top 1-20 are restricted – see Section 1.6 
  1. Sum of player/pair’s published points: 
  • PPA Tour Asia points multiplied by two (2), until such time that PPA Tour Asia announce an update 
  • PPA Tour points (actual value) 
  • PPA Tour Australia points (actual value) 
  1. Up to six (6) Main Draw Wildcards 
  1. Up to four (4) Qualifying Wildcards 

1.3.2 Cup Format Entry Priority 

Entries for Cup Format tournaments shall be processed as follows, based on rankings captured at registration closing: 

  1. Players positioned in the Top 50 of the PPA Tour Rankings (inclusive of their partners in doubles events) – No elite player restrictions apply 
  1. Sum of player/pair’s published points: 
  • PPA Tour Asia points multiplied by three (3), until such time that PPA Tour Asia announce an update 
  • PPA Tour points (actual value) 
  • PPA Tour Australia points (actual value) 
  1. Up to six (6) Main Draw Wildcards 
  1. Up to four (4) Qualifying Wildcards 

1.4 Tie-Breaking Procedures 

When Entry Points are equal, player/pair order will be determined in the following priority: 

  1. PPA Tour Asia points 
  2. PPA Tour points 
  3. PPA Tour Australia points 
  4. DUPR rating 
  5. Random draw 

1.5 Wildcard Allocation

1.5.1 Main Draw Wildcards

Up to six (6) wildcards may be allocated for the Main Draw as follows: 

  • Two (2) Local Wildcards
  • Two (2) Host Wildcards
  • Two (2) PPA Tour Asia Wildcards


1.5.2 Qualifying Wildcards 

Up to four (4) wildcards may be allocated for the Qualifying Draw at the discretion of PPA Tour Asia. 

1.6 Elite Player Participation Limit (EPPL) – Open Format Only

This restriction applies to Open Format tournaments only. Players positioned 1-20 in the PPA Tour Rankings at Registration Closing are not permitted to enter through standard entry procedures in an Open Format event. Such players may only participate if awarded a wildcard. 

Cup Format tournaments have no elite player restrictions – all Top 50 PPA Tour ranked players may enter through standard entry procedures. 

2. SEEDING SYSTEM 

2.1 Seeding Determination 

All seeding shall be determined using rankings and points captured at time of registration closing. 

  1. Players (and their partners) positioned 1-50 in the PPA Tour Rankings shall be seeded according to their PPA Tour ranking position. 
  2. All other players/pairs shall then be seeded by the sum of published: 
  3. PPA Tour Asia points multiplied by three (3x)
  4. PPA Tour points (actual value) 
  5. PPA Tour Australia points (actual value) 

2.2 Tie-Breaking Procedures 

When Entry Points are equal, player/pair order will be determined in the following priority: 

  • PPA Tour Asia points 
  • PPA Tour points 
  • PPA Tour Australia points 
  • DUPR rating 
  • Random draw 

 2.3 Seed Placement in Draw

2.3.1 Main Draw Placement – Open Format (16 Draw) 

Seeds shall be placed in the draw according to the following procedures: 

  • Seed 1: Placed in slot 1 
  • Seed 2: Placed in slot 16 
  • Seeds 3-4: Drawn randomly with first drawn placed in slot 8, second drawn placed in slot 9 
  • Remaining players: Players/pairs drawn and placed in vacant slots starting from the top of the draw (excluding slots reserved for qualifying winners) 

2.3.2 Main Draw Placement – Cup Format (32 Draw) 

For Cup format events with 32-player main draw: 

Seed Placement:  

Top 8 seeds will be drawn into the below positions:

  • Seed 1: Position 1 
  • Seed 2: Position 32 
  • Seeds 3-4: Drawn randomly with first drawn placed in position 16, second drawn placed in position 17 
  • Seeds 5-8: Drawn randomly and placed in positions 8,9,24,25 
  • All 8 seeds will be given a bye to the round of 16. 
  • Main Draw first round:  8 players will be randomly drawn to meet 8 qualifying winners, starting from the top of the draw 
  • Qualifying Round: 8 players will proceed to Main Draw round of 32. 

2.3.3 Qualifying Winners Placement 

Qualifying winners shall be randomly drawn and placed to fill the TBD slots in sequential order of main draw seeds (Open Format) or distributed evenly across the round of 32 (Cup Format). 

2.3.4 Qualifying Draw Placement 

Seeds shall be placed in the qualifying draw according to the following procedures in a 16-player draw:

  • Seed 1: Placed in slot 1
  • Seed 2: Placed in slot 16
  • Seeds 3-4: Drawn randomly with first drawn placed in slot 8, second drawn placed in slot 9
  • Remaining players: Players/pairs drawn and placed in vacant slots starting from the top of the draw

2.3.4 Draw Procedure 

The placement of seeds shall not be official until the final draw is completed and published.


3. IMPLEMENTATION
 

These regulations shall apply to all Pro events at Open level PPA Tour Asia tournaments unless otherwise specified. All decisions regarding entry and seeding determinations shall be final and binding.
